Plenty of French politicians simultaneously serve as mayors, both local and regional, while holding seats in the national legislature. Chirac was Mayor of Paris and a Deputy in the AssemblΓ©e Nationale and Prime Minster (and an MEP at one point).

Incidentally, this was explained by my brilliant A-Level Economics teacher in the late 1990s: we shouldn’t view the railcard price as discounted, but rather the normal price; whereas it’s the absence of the railcard for business travellers that allows their prices to be drastically inflated.
